why is safe sex important ?
Prevents sexually transmitted infections (STIs) One of the most important reasons to practice safer sex is to prevent the transmission of STIs. Diseases such as chlamydia, gonorrhoea, syphilis, human papillomavirus (HPV) and HIV are spread through sexual contact. These infections can have long-term health consequences, including infertility, chronic pain and even life-threatening conditions. How to have safe sex as a woman
As a woman, practicing safe sex is essential for protecting your health and well-being. One of the most important steps is using barrier methods, such as condoms and dental dams, to prevent sexually transmitted infections (STIs). Even if you or your partner use other forms of birth control, like birth control pills, IUDs, or implants, condoms remain necessary for STI protection. Regular STI testing is also crucial, especially if you have multiple partners or a new partner. Additionally, getting vaccinated against HPV and hepatitis B can provide extra protection against certain infections. Open communication with your partner about sexual history, boundaries, and protection methods is key to ensuring a safe and respectful sexual experience.
Beyond physical protection, safe sex also involves making informed choices and prioritizing your well-being. Avoiding sexual activity while under the influence of drugs or alcohol helps ensure you can make clear and consensual decisions. If you're in a long-term relationship and considering not using condoms, both you and your partner should get tested for STIs beforehand. It’s also important to know how to recognize signs of STIs, such as unusual discharge, pain, or sores, and to seek medical attention if needed. Lastly, practicing self-care, staying educated about sexual health, and advocating for your own comfort and boundaries will help you maintain a positive and safe sexual experience.
